  • Patent number: 8751695
    Abstract: A hybrid storage device is provided. The hybrid storage device includes a first storage part that comprises an interface device based on a first standard, a second storage part that comprises an interface device based on a second standard, and a connector for interface devices that is shared by the first storage part and the second storage part and comprises a plurality of pins.

  • Patent number: 8626985
    Abstract: Provided are a hybrid optical disk drive, a method of driving the hybrid optical disk drive, and an electronic system including the hybrid optical disk drive. The hybrid optical disk drive may include an optical disk drive unit for recording/storing data in an optical disk and a solid-state drive (SSD) unit having a storage capacity that is equal to or greater than a maximum storage capacity of the optical disk, which is compatible with the hybrid optical disk drive.

  • Patent number: 8262218
    Abstract: An optical recording/reproducing apparatus includes an optical disc drive unit for recording/reproducing information with respect to a recording surface of an optical disc, a label printer module for printing a label on a label surface of the optical disc, and an optical disc support apparatus separated from the optical disc during recording/reproduction of the information, and supporting the optical disc to allow the label surface of the optical disc to be located at a printable position with respect to the label printer module during printing of the label.
